Explore innovative flexibility concepts for geodesic flow in this hour-long lecture presented by Alena Erchenko as part of the Fall 2023 Big Ideas In Dynamics series. Delve into advanced mathematical principles and their applications in dynamic systems, gaining insights into the intricate relationships between geometry and motion. Examine cutting-edge research and theoretical frameworks that push the boundaries of our understanding of geodesic flows and their flexibility properties.
